The Farm School - Current Status

Current Status

Today the Farm's population has leveled off at about 175 residents. As new crops of young families seeking a lifestyle that combines environmental, political and spiritual awareness discover the potential and opportunity the community has to offer, they also struggle with the existing processes and agreements of the community. This has resulted in a disparity in age that leans toward a larger number of baby boomers (about 80%), many of whom have lived on The Farm for most of its existence. Those interested in becoming residents are encouraged to visit during the bi-annual Farm Experience Weekend, an inside look at how the community operates and functions and the agreements that have enabled it to survive for over 35 years.
